Netherlands takes first place at European Softball Junior Girls
The Netherlands won the European Softball Championship Junior Girls, which ended last Sunday in Deggendorf Germany. They defeated Italy 4-3, which had all games before. The Dutch took a 4-0 lead and held off an Italian rally in the end to seal the win.
Italy had reached the final through an 8-0 shutout against the Netherlands in the semi-finals. They had to go through the Bronze Medal Game, beating the Czech Republic 9-8 in nine innings, while overcoming a 0-6 deficit. The Czech defeated Russia 10-3 in the second semi-final to finish in third. Host Germany took fifth place.
Greece took the title in the B-Pool, beating Romania 4-2 in the finals. Great Britain finished in third place.
Awards:
A-Pool:
Best Batter: Karolina Dologova (CZE)
Best Pitcher: Michela Musitelli (ITA)
MVP: Anne Vlietstra (NED)
B-Pool:
Best Batter: Stephanie Pearce (GBR)
Best Pitcher: Afroditi Kouroukli (GRE)
MVP: Gabriela Moraru (ROM)
